Tanzania forest to be protected as a result of major scientific discoveries

Wednesday, January 16, 2019 - 08:00 in Biology & Nature

The United Republic of Tanzania has announced it will protect a globally unique forest ecosystem in East Africa, following research that demonstrated it is under threat from illegal activities including tree-cutting for charcoal and the poaching of elephants and other animals.
